CVE-2023-54221
Published: Dec 30, 2025
Modified: May 11, 2026
Description
In the Linux kernel, the following vulnerability has been resolved: clk: imx93: fix memory leak and missing unwind goto in imx93_clocks_probe In function probe(), it returns directly without unregistered hws when error occurs. Fix this by adding 'goto unregister_hws;' on line 295 and line 310. Use devm_kzalloc() instead of kzalloc() to automatically free the memory using devm_kfree() when error occurs. Replace of_iomap() with devm_of_iomap() to automatically handle the unused ioremap region and delete 'iounmap(anatop_base);' in unregister_hws.
| Vendor | Product | Versions |
|---|---|---|
Linux | Linux | affected 24defbe194b650218680fcd9dec8cd103537b531 - < 280a5ff665e12d1e0c54c20cedc9c5008aa686a5affected 24defbe194b650218680fcd9dec8cd103537b531 - < fac9c624138c4bc021d7a8ee3b974c9e10926d92affected 24defbe194b650218680fcd9dec8cd103537b531 - < d17c16a2b2a6589c45b0bfb1b9914da80b72d89eaffected 24defbe194b650218680fcd9dec8cd103537b531 - < e02ba11b457647050cb16e7cad16cec3c252fade |
Linux | Linux | affected 5.18unaffected 0 - < 5.18unaffected 6.1.39 - <= 6.1.*unaffected 6.3.13 - <= 6.3.*unaffected 6.4.4 - <= 6.4.*+1 more versions |
Security Training
Train your team to recognize and prevent security threats with our comprehensive security awareness program.
Start TrainingVulnerability Scanning
Discover vulnerabilities in your applications and infrastructure before attackers do.
Scan Now